L’OrĂ©al Infallible Paints Blush Palette and Liquid Eyeliner Review

Recently I reviewed the vibrant Lip Paints from L’Oreal so today I’ll be exploring more of this trendy collection which includes a wide variety of bold colors for spring and summer.


I never leave home without applying my liner and a splash of color along the lash line does wonders for the eyes. Although many of us are most comfortable with basic black or deep brown, daring shades are also very stylish. The Infallible Paints Liquid Eyeliner ($12.99) is available in 6 show stopping hues that instantly amp-up your eye shadow. They also look great winged-out on bare lids with lengthening mascara or falsies for a little extra drama.


The thin, flexible felt tip is only 0.5mm so you can create sleek, high-impact lines and amazing definition. Since the formula is highly saturated I can achieve one-stroke application with no skipping or sheerness and the color dries fast and lasts all day!


Bottom to top: White Party, Intrepid Teal, Electric Blue, Wild Green, Vivid Aqua and Black Party

The Infallible Paints Blush Palette ($19.99) is stunning and I think these shades are suitable for all complexions. The color applies sheer to medium with the versatility to be intensified for the perfect level of saturation. The consistency is on the dry side but blends well with no caking, flaking or accentuating skin texture. I love the matte, complexion boosting finish and you can also mix or layer to create your own tint. If you aren’t comfortable with vibrant pigment don’t let the boldness deter you. The shades on the end can be quite mild and the brighter blushes can be toned down substantially. The palette also comes with a small, coarse brush that leaves much to be desired but there isn’t really room for anything larger. L’Oreal is available at drugstores nationwide.

Clarins Hydra-Essentiel Skincare Review

The human body is comprised of about 60% water making it essential for daily functioning but many of us are not drinking the daily requirement. A hectic scheduled combined with pollution, fluctuations in weather, indoor heating or cooling systems and poor air quality can all lead to dehydrated, tired looking skin.

The new Hydra-Essentiel Collection from Clarins is the latest generation of anti-pollution skincare. Infused with organic Leaf of Life Extract harvested from Madagascar, the potent formula restores the skin’s water reservoirs to help retain moisture despite sudden temperature changes.


During the winter my skin can get parched and flaky but this year dryness wasn’t an issue! The Intensive Moisture Quenching bi-phase serum has a refreshing water base that deeply hydrates alleviates discomfort and absorbs quickly leaving skin supple, regenerated and smooth. The liquid tends to separate into light blue and deep blue so before use I shake well, pat on a generous amount and allow it to dry. There is no residue and it works well under makeup keeping my skin soft and protected without the accumulation of excess oil or grease. The cool invigorating sensation feels like a replenishing drink for the skin and the effects last all day. The serum retails for $56.00.


The Hydra-Essentiel Moisturizer ($46.00) is a lush, silky formula that works wonders day or night and when layered over the serum it maximizes hydration levels to nourish dull, stressed skin. The luxurious texture glides across the face bathing the skin in layers of lightweight dewy moisture with no stickiness or grease. My skin feels soft, even, smooth and revitalized with no rough patches and it seems to reduce pore size and enhance brightness for a radiant finish.


The Lotus Face Treatment Oil ($57.00) is not part of this amazing collection but when layered over the serum and moisturizer it creates the ultimate night recovery mask to revive and energize the skin as you get your beauty sleep. You can also use one of the Clarins Boosters on top of the Hydra-Essentiel range if you don’t have the oil but either way the reparative ingredients absorb deeply so I awake with clear, velvety skin! The Lotus Oil is comprised of 100% pure plant extracts that purify, balance, refine hydrate and improve oily or combination skin which equals less blemishes, pimples and discoloration.


Another product I’ve been using frequently is the Daily Energizer Cream which is rich in vitamin C, turmeric, alchemilla and gingko biloba to revitalize and prepare your skin for the day. Under makeup I use Clarins moisturizers more than any other brand and this light, cooling cream melts in efficiently, soothes and hydrates for a fresh, healthy glow. It retails for $29.00.

Marcelle Cosmetics Rouge Xpression Lipstick Review

Years ago I wrote an article on the Rouge Xpression Lipsticks from Marcelle and since then these smooth, trendy shades have remained some of my favorites! Although you can find them at your local drugstore, the quality and brilliant finishes are comparable to high-end formulas and if you appreciate stunning color and luxurious comfort it’s easy to find a variety of flattering hues to enhance your complexion.


The unique gel texture makes the pigment velvety smooth and cushiony for one-stroke coverage. These are the type of lipsticks you can apply effortlessly and mess-free while on-the-go and the ultra-lightweight color is buildable, highly saturated and pure with a hint of satiny shine.

The pearl finishes are a bit more radiant and beautifully reflective whereas the creams are solid, rich and buttery. No matter which shade you choose, prepare to fall in love because I haven’t found a color I didn’t like. The gluten-free, hypoallergenic formula is gentle, fragrance-free and very hydrating so as the color wears away lips remain supple and moist.

French Rose is a bright bubble gum pink with a frosty finish that is great for spring!


Passion is a bronzy-red pearl with a hint of burnt orange and Cleopatra is a beautiful deep mauve.


Royal Berry is from the Rouge Vitality Collection but it has similar color payoff and a bold, creamy finish. Fuchsia Flare has the perfect balance of bright pink and deep berry which creates a universally flattering mid-tone hue.


On the neutral end of the spectrum you have Euphoria - a luminous bronze and Delight which has a lovely pink undertone that keeps lips from appearing washed-out.

L’Occitane Limited Edition Hand Cream Collection & Intensive Hand Balm Review

Nothing ruins a cute manicure like dry hands and with frequent washing, sanitizers and harsh weather, it can be difficult to keep skin soft and youthful. Thankfully L’Occitane has luxurious creams and balms infused with rich oils, moisturizing butters and natural plant extracts that heal, nourish and revitalize.


Valentine’s Day may be over but there is still time to get the stylish Hand Cream Gift Set with pampering ingredients sourced from the South of France. These creams are some of my favorites for travel and I keep one in my purse to replenish my hands throughout the day. The set comes with 5 fashionable tubes (Verbena, Cherry Blossom, Pivoine Flora, Rose and Almond) all designed with bright, feminine artwork. The ingredient list includes skin softening components like Coconut, Shea, Sweet Almond Oil, Cherry Extract, Rosemary and Sunflower to treat cracked, damaged skin, repair cuticles, smooth roughness and hydrate with a lightweight silky finish. The set is valued at $60.00 but retails for $50.00 while supplies last.


If winter has taken a toll on your hands, the Intensive Balm is a fabulous treatment for eradicating flakiness and extremely parched skin. The formula contains a high concentration of Shea Butter that penetrates deeply and forms a protective layer over hands, nails and cuticles for instant dryness relief and softness. Although the balm is ultra-rich and a bit difficult to squeeze out of the tube, there is no greasy residue. You can also use it as a recuperative hand mask by applying a generous amount and allowing it to seep in for 10 minutes before blotting off the excess. The balm is great for men who suffer from peeling, damaged skin, those who work outdoors, and professionals who hand wash frequently including nurses, teachers and doctors. The tube is 125 ml and retails for $40.00.


The Shea Collection consists of many lush, hydrating products but one of my favorites is the Foaming Cleanser ($28.00). This smooth, creamy emulsion removes impurities, makeup residue, excess oil and traces of pollution without leaving my face stiff and dry. It can be used morning or night for a soft, fresh complexion.

The Body Shop Drops Of Light Pure Healthy Brightening Serum and Tea Tree Oil Review

Today’s post is dedicated to blemished skin which is a pesky problem that can affect makeup application and put a damper on your self esteem. Currently my complexion is clear, bright and silky but occasionally I spend too much time in the sun, experience mild discoloration or get an annoying pimple that requires treatment. 


When applied on a regular basis, a brightening serum can help fade hyperpigmentation and scarring to even and correct skin tone. The Drops of Light Serum is enriched with natural plant extracts and Red Algae that contains high levels of Vitamin C to brighten, retexture, heal, smooth and nourish. This potent blend has a lightweight, non-greasy formula that absorbs quickly for a silky, supple finish and the scent is wonderful! I usually layer it under moisturizer for more hydration and after several trips to the Caribbean I’ve noticed a luminizing effect that has lifted my tan, revitalized my complexion and reversed some environmental damage. The serum retails for $38.00.


Another great product for blemished skin is the Tea Tree Anti-Imperfection Daily Solution Oil. The Body Shop has hand-harvested these precious organic botanicals and steam distilled the formula within 12 hours to yield the most potent Tea Tree elixir. This fragrant oil delivers an efficient dose to help balance, correct and amplify radiance for healthy looking skin. The strong herbal aroma tends to mellow with wear and 2 drops coats the entire face, absorbs deeply and leaves behind no residue. Although the texture does make skin feel soft and smooth I usually combine it with my face cream, night mask or serum for more moisture. The oil retails for $25.00.
